Combination Play - Give and Go - Commit Player (drive at them)
- Driving at the defender
- Keeping the ball on the side of the support player
- Awareness of the position of the defender whether to use give and go or use support player as a decoy

Instructions:
Player A takes a touch to either side to begin the activity then plays to B. B opens up and finds C. On C's first touch A becomes a passive defender and applies pressure to C. C beats A by combining with B using a give and go
Rotation: A to B, B to C, C to A.
Coaching Points:
- Quality of check
- Communication
- Quality of pass
- Drive at defender's front foot
- Keep ball close, touch on every step
- Play late as possible with outside foot
- Direction and weight of return pass
- Quick movement to receive the ball back again
Progressions:
- Attacker can choose to scissor instead of give and go
- Defender (A) is now live and trys to win the ball. Play 2v1 game to endlines. Keep score.

Instructions:
A plays to B who opens up and plays to C. C drives at A and beats them with a scissor.
Coaching Points:
- Quality of movement (timing)
- Quality of first touch/passing
- Communication
- Quality of move

Organization:
1v1 + 2 Nuetral Players start off on the flank, in a 30x40 yard grid, using 2 small goals.
Instructions:
Players play a 1 vs 1 game for 2 minutes, they have two support players either side of the field they can use to help get past the defender. Support players must stay on outside of field and only have one touch.
Coaching Points:
* Drive at defender
* Look to commit them
* Observation of defender before deciding what to do
* Angle/distance of support of neutral players
* Use of correct surface to pass the ball
Progression:
Players may enter field of play to make quicker combination.
